UmBrush was an interactive installation that allowed users to draw with light on the outdoor physical environment. The interface station was placed in a hallway, and the image was projected from the roof of the building onto the umbrellas in the outdoor eating area of Art Center College of Design cafe.Below is the text that was written on the station podium: What happens when you retrieve these umbrellas from the darkness and paint them with light?They come forward from the shadows and begin to dance, reactivating a space that is so visible throughout the day becomes invisible at night .
